Introduction:

Bactrian camels, also known as the Mongolian camel, are fascinating creatures with a long history of interaction with humans. These unique animals have adapted to harsh desert environments and have been a crucial part of transportation and trade in the Silk Road region for centuries. Fact 1: Bactrian camels are native to the steppes of Central Asia.

One of the most interesting facts about Bactrian camels is that they are native to the vast steppes of Central Asia, including regions in Mongolia, China, Russia, and Iran. These camels have evolved to survive in extreme temperatures and can endure harsh desert conditions with little water or vegetation.

Fact 2: Bactrian camels have two humps, unlike their Arabian camel cousins.

Unlike Arabian camels, which have a single hump, Bactrian camels have two distinctive humps on their backs. These humps are filled with fat reserves that provide energy and sustenance during long periods without food or water.

Fact 3: Bactrian camels are incredibly strong and can carry heavy loads.

Bactrian camels are known for their strength and endurance, making them ideal for transporting goods across vast desert terrain. These camels can carry up to 1,000 pounds of cargo and travel long distances without tiring, making them invaluable for trade and transportation in remote regions.

Fact 4: Bactrian camels have a unique ability to close their nostrils to protect against sandstorms.

One fascinating adaptation of Bactrian camels is their ability to close their nostrils completely, preventing sand and dust from entering their airways during sandstorms. This unique adaptation allows them to survive in the harsh desert environment without damaging their respiratory system.

Fact 5: Bactrian camels can go weeks without water.

Due to their ability to store fat reserves in their humps and conserve water efficiently, Bactrian camels can survive for weeks without access to water. This adaptation allows them to thrive in arid desert conditions where other animals would struggle to survive.

Fact 6: Bactrian camels have thick, shaggy fur to protect them from extreme temperatures.

The thick, shaggy fur coat of Bactrian camels helps insulate them from the extreme temperatures of the desert, keeping them warm during cold nights and cool during scorching hot days. Their fur also provides protection against sand and dust, helping them stay comfortable in their harsh environment.

Fact 7: Bactrian camels are highly social animals that form strong bonds with their herdmates.

These fascinating creatures are known for their social nature and form strong bonds within their herds. Bactrian camels communicate through vocalizations, body language, and even spitting to establish hierarchy and maintain social harmony within the group.

Fact 8: Bactrian camels have long, curved eyelashes to protect their eyes from sand and dust.

To protect their eyes from sand and dust during sandstorms, Bactrian camels have long, thick, curved eyelashes that act as natural shields. These eyelashes help keep their eyes safe and free from irritation in the harsh desert environment.

Fact 9: Bactrian camels can run at speeds of up to 40 miles per hour.

Despite their seemingly slow and steady demeanor, Bactrian camels are surprisingly fast runners and can reach speeds of up to 40 miles per hour when motivated. This agility helps them escape predators and cover long distances quickly when needed.

Fact 10: Bactrian camel milk is highly nutritious and has medicinal properties.

Bactrian camels produce rich and nutritious milk that is prized for its high protein and vitamin content. This milk is believed to have medicinal properties and is used in traditional Mongolian and Chinese medicine to treat various ailments and boost immunity.

Fact 11: Bactrian camels have a strong sense of smell and can detect water sources from miles away.

With their keen sense of smell, Bactrian camels are able to detect water sources from miles away, guiding their nomadic herders to vital sources of hydration in the desert. This ability helps ensure their survival in arid environments where water is scarce.

Fact 12: Bactrian camels have a unique chewing motion that helps them break down tough desert vegetation.

Bactrian camels have a distinctive chewing motion that allows them to break down tough desert vegetation and extract nutrients efficiently. This adaptation helps them thrive on sparse vegetation found in desert regions and makes them well-suited for their environment.

Fact 13: Bactrian camels can live up to 50 years in captivity.

With proper care and nutrition, Bactrian camels can live up to 50 years in captivity, making them long-lived animals that form lasting bonds with their human caretakers. Their longevity and resilience have made them valuable companions and working animals throughout history.

Fact 14: Bactrian camels have been domesticated for over 4,000 years.

Humans have been domesticating Bactrian camels for over 4,000 years, using them for transportation, trade, and milk production in the harsh desert environments of Central Asia. These remarkable animals have played a crucial role in the development of trade routes and civilizations in the region.

Fact 15: Bactrian camels are listed as critically endangered species.

Despite their long history of interaction with humans, Bactrian camels are now considered critically endangered due to habitat loss, hunting, and competition with livestock for resources. Conservation efforts are underway to protect these unique animals and ensure their survival for future generations.
